Load Shift and Field Tracking Risks:
Adjust 3-point hitch arms and sway blocks to minimize any
side-to-side sway to assure proper tracking in the field and
safe road travel.
Refer to Figure 4
6.
Connect your lower tractor 3-point arms
to the
planter 3-point hitch. If using quick hitch be sure
planter locks into hitch securely.
This is a semi-mounted implement.
• The flexible top link
,
may be used, with care, in
certain situations.
• If the top link is not used, you may optionally use lift-
assist weight transfer to apply some of the cart weight
to the openers during planting.
Excess 3-point Weight and Steering Hazard:
Do not use the top-link and weight-transfer capabilities at the
same time. Planter caster wheels may lift off ground. Tractor
steering wheels may lose effectiveness. An accident is possible,
resulting in serious injury or death, and planter damage.
Refer to Figure 5
If using lift-assist weight-transfer (and not using the 3-
point top link), make sure the parallel arms are config-
ured as follows:
7.
Install the lift-assist weight-transfer pins
. The pins
are stored in a plate behind the cart parallel arm
pivot weldment. Install them in the large holes at the
bottom of the rod-end lug in the frame-to-cart parallel
arms.
8.
Remove the lift-assist shear bolts from the small
holes
below the lift-assist rod-end lug upper pivot
pin. Store the bolts in the plates behind the cart par-
allel arm pivot weldments.
If using the 3-point top link, make sure the parallel arms
are configured as follows:
9.
Install the lift-assist shear bolts. Spare bolts are
stored in a plate behind the cart parallel arm pivot
weldment. Secure the bolt in the small hole
below
the lift-assist rod-end lug upper pivot pin.
10. Remove the lift-assist weight-transfer pins
. These
are located at the bottom of the rod-end lug in the
frame-to-cart parallel arms. The pin is stored in a
plate behind the cart parallel arm pivot weldment.
